What An Evening

by Joel Schenk

A lone explorer pauses and soaks in the views while Mt. Foraker looms in an array of clouds some 14 miles away. With almost 24 hours of daylight, this post 23:00hr shot could have been handheld, but I opted for my Gitzo as the telephoto lens was pushed to 100mm. Image captured from 14K camp in early June 2007. Denali National Park, Alaska.
Equipment: Nikon N80, Fuji Velvia 100
